As one of the major tea-producing provinces in China, Zhejiang Province occupies an important position in China's tea exports. Among the agricultural exports, Zhejiang is the province with more exports. Among its many export agricultural products, tea accounts for the majority. The impact of tea exports is large for Zhejiang, and the economic benefits are also considerable. In recent years, competition in the domestic and international beverage markets has become increasingly fierce. The sales of Zhejiang tea have been challenged in many ways, while the EU, the US and Japan are major players.
Since China’s accession to the World Trade Organization, China’s foreign trade has been continuously strengthened. With the concept of green trade barriers and the adoption of serious trade protection measures by importing countries, it has caused some impact on China’s foreign trade. It also brought a series of bad consequences to the tea export trade in Zhejiang Province. As a result, the export and foreign trade of the whole agricultural products in Zhejiang Province showed a downward trend, which had a bad influence on the income of farmers in Zhejiang Province and the Zhejiang economy. Zhejiang Province, as China's current major exporter of tea, plays a very important role in the export of foreign trade in China's tea industry. This paper analyzes the current situation of Zhejiang tea export trade, finds out the problems of Zhejiang tea export trade, and puts forward countermeasures to improve the international competitiveness of Zhejiang tea industry and increase tea export trade in Zhejiang Province.
